Keywords

Google local search engine optimization (SEO), is a set of strategies and tactics you employ over time to improve your business's rankings for local search terms on Google. These search terms indicate that someone is searching for a specific business in their location.

You should first determine the most relevant phrases your potential customers search for when looking for services or products similar to yours in order to rank for local seo company keywords. You can use keyword research tools to identify a list of these terms and those that might be related to them.

Once you have your list, you can start incorporating them into your web copy and other content. This will help you get higher rankings in search results and increase local traffic to your website.

Another crucial aspect to take into consideration is the type of keywords you want to target. For instance, while national SEO concentrates on keywords that are related to your business , but without a geographical qualifying word Local SEO requires more effort from you to focus on keywords that indicate that the user is looking for a specific business in their local area.

The most effective way to get started with your local SEO is to create an inventory of the most well-known services you provide and the areas you service. This will provide you with plenty of ideas on the types of keywords you should be targeting.

Next, look at your competitors to find out what keywords they are using. You can also check out their Google Business profiles to see what they are doing to optimize for local searches.

Last but not last, think about your business' name and address. This is known as NAP. It should be consistent across all your business listings, including your website. This will ensure that Google will consider your business legitimate when it ranks local results in search results that are relevant to you.

It is important to make sure that your company's name and address are correct on all social media accounts. These details will aid in ranking higher for local search terms and improve your visibility on Google Maps.

Optimization of the page

By adding localized content to your website will assist you in ranking higher in search engine results pages (SERPs) for terms that are relevant to your business. This can boost your visibility and increase customer satisfaction.

Utilizing high-volume keywords in the title, header, and meta description of your page can also help your site get more visibility in the results of Google. Incorporating customer success stories and case studies on your page will increase the conversion rate which will increase traffic to your site.

It is essential to update your website regularly with new content, just as with all SEO. Be it new product information blog posts, blog posts, or updates on social media it's essential to keep your site up-to-date and regularly optimized for local SEO.

The best method to optimize your site for local search is to make sure your company's NAP (Name, address, and phone number) is consistent across all platforms. This includes your website, GMB listing and other directories on the internet.

Additionally, you must make sure that your URLs and titles for your services refer to specific areas of the world. For example, you might have an appropriate service keyword, such as "boiler installation" as well as a different service keyword like "burst pipe repair."

Local schemas can be used to create structured data for each page on your website. This can aid in ranking higher in local search results, and even the "snack pack" which Google uses to determine local search results.

Finally, you should maintain an ongoing relationship with your customers and encourage them to leave reviews on websites where they are able to leave reviews. This will boost your site's credibility, which will in turn increase your rank on SERPs. It also will encourage local business leads to connect with you.

Listing on Google My Business (GMB).

If you're a local business that operates online, it's vital to have a Google My Business (GMB) listing. This free tool lets you to optimize and increase your online visibility.

GMB allows you to reach customers by the display of your name, location and hours of operation etc. in search results. It helps you stand out from your local competitors.

A current and complete GMB profile can significantly improve your local SEO ranking. Customers can also leave reviews on your GMB pages.

Another benefit of the GMB listing is the ability to make estimates or book appointments. This feature makes it easy to locate the services you need and make an appointment swiftly.

You should ensure that your contact information is correct and current when you create your GMB list. This includes your address, name telephone number, address, and email. It is also important to add your website URL and social media links to your GMB listing.

After you have updated your Google My Business listing make sure you check in with it often. It's possible that Google might update your listing if they find any mistakes in your information.

It is also essential to include pictures of your company on your GMB listing. These images will help you gain more local seo marketing exposure and will encourage Google users to visit your site.

Geo-tagging is the best way to do this. Google will display your images alongside the results of searches for nearby locations.

If you operate from multiple locations, it's recommended you create a location group for each. This will ensure that all your listings appear in the same location on Google and enable you to manage them easily.

You should have a detailed GMB profile and precise business hours. This will help your site rank higher in the local map pack and improve the number of customers who convert.

Reviews

In short, Google local seo is the process of optimizing your website and Google My Business (GMB) listing for location-specific keywords. These keywords are used to help local customers find businesses that provide services close to them. The aim is to boost your search engine rankings so that you show up in the "local packs" which are displayed at the top of Google's search results page to potential customers who type in keywords related to purchases or services.

Local SEO is incomplete without reviews. They can provide valuable information to search engines regarding your business' reputation. This information can then be used to determine your ranking in search results.

BrightLocal research on consumer behavior shows that 84% of consumers trust reviews more than personal recommendations when it comes time to choose local businesses. It's not surprising that Google prominently shows reviews on its local properties.

But if your reviews aren't up to par then you could miss out on potential customers and could hurt your search engine ranking. This is why it's crucial to monitor your reviews, and respond swiftly and with empathy to negative reviews and make use of technology to keep track of all your reviews in one location.

Review quantity, diversity and speed are three key metrics that affect the local seo for small business rank of your business on Google. Moz has found that these three factors make up 15% of a business's local pack rank.

Continuously updating your reviews will also improve your search engine rankings since it shows potential customers that your business is up-to-date and you don't have to rely on a bunch of old reviews. 73% of customers dislike companies with reviews that are older than 3 months.

Be vigilant about your reviews is critical because they can help you identify and eliminate false reviews from your Google My Business (GMB) page. Google will notice if your respond quickly to any reviews. This shows that you take customer service seriously and care about the opinions of your customers.
